Recently attempted to open Meshlab on computer. I am using a Dell Precision 7710 running Windows 10. The program opens just fine but when I go to File -> Import Mesh the program processes for a few seconds and then immediately crashes/closes down before I can open a mesh. No error report is generated. I further tested this using the commands "File -> Open Project" and "File -> Export Mesh". Both of these also immediately caused the program to crash. Anything that interacts with File Explorer seems to immediately crash. I can still create a new mesh layer.

Opening a file by double-clicking on it directly in File Explorer when it is set to always open .stl/.ply files in Meshlab will cause it to successfully open, though I have not checked if all other functions are working.

I am unsure what is causing this error. I uninstalled Meshlab (originally version 2022) and reinstalled the latest version on my computer, the issue still persists. My computer originally ran Windows 7 or Vista and was upgraded to Windows 10. That is the only thing I could think that could be causing these errors.
